Question of the day

A function block is enclosed with?

Explanation:
In JavaScript, a function block is enclosed with curly braces, which are represented by the `{}` symbols. This is essential because curly braces define the boundaries of a block of code that belongs to a specific function. When you define a function, you use the function keyword followed by the function name and parentheses for parameters; then, you open a curly brace to start the function body, which contains the code that will execute when the function is called. The use of curly braces helps to group statements together, allowing the function to control the scope of variables declared within it and maintain clean, organized code. This makes it clear where the function begins and ends, which is crucial for the readability and maintainability of code. Other types of brackets serve different purposes in JavaScript; for instance, parentheses `()` are used for enclosing function parameters and controlling the order of operations in expressions, while square brackets `[]` are used for array definitions and indexing. The combination of parentheses and square brackets as seen in the last option does not correspond to any conventional syntax for defining function blocks. Thus, curly braces are the correct choice for enclosing the body of a function.

What to Expect on the Exam

Preparing for the JavaScript Certification Test involves understanding a broad spectrum of topics relevant to modern web development. Key areas include:

  • JavaScript Basics: Variables, data types, operators, control structures, functions.
  • DOM Manipulation: Selecting, editing, and making dynamic changes to HTML using JavaScript.
  • ES6 and Beyond: Updated syntax including let and const, arrow functions, promises, async/await.
  • JavaScript Frameworks: Basic understanding of popular frameworks like React, Angular, or Vue.js.
  • Error Handling: Techniques to diagnose and manage errors efficiently in code.
  • Asynchronous Programming: Understanding of callbacks, promises, and async functions.

Real-world applications and hypothetical scenarios are often integrated into questions to test practical knowledge and problem-solving abilities.
